Ferries from Mljet (All Ports) to Sućuraj, Hvar do 2 crossings per week from June to September, departures take place at the Pomena, Mljet ports. The earliest ferry leaves from Pomena, Mljet at 16:30, and the latest at 16:30 from Pomena, Mljet. The fastest ferry, departing from Pomena, Mljet, takes 1h 35min, while the average journey duration is 1h 35min. Ticket prices range from €25.00 to €25.00. Can you bring a car on the ferry from Mljet (All Ports) to Sućuraj, Hvar?
Ferries from Mljet (All Ports) to Sućuraj, Hvar don’t carry vehicles. Only foot passengers are permitted.

Getting to the ferry ports in Mljet (All Ports)
To reach the Pomena ferry terminal in Mljet, you'll find it conveniently located near the center of Pomena village, just a short walk from local accommodations and restaurants. It’s about a 30-minute drive from the nearest major airport, Dubrovnik Airport, making it accessible by car or taxi. If you’re relying on public transport, buses connect the airport to Dubrovnik, where you can take additional buses to Pomena, typically taking around 1.5 to 2 hours in total.
The ferry terminal in Sućuraj, Hvar, is situated at the eastern tip of the island, just a few minutes from the village center. It’s easily reachable by car or taxi from popular Hvar Town, which is approximately a 30-40 minute drive away.

Make the most of your time in Sućuraj, Hvar
Sućuraj, Hvar is a charming little town that’s perfect for fun adventures! This beautiful place is known for its lovely beaches, like the sandy Mali Porat, where you can splash in the clear blue water. Make sure to visit the old church of St. Nicholas, which has a tall bell tower that gives you amazing views of the sea.
If you love nature, take a stroll along the scenic paths or explore the nearby hills, where you can see colorful flowers and maybe even some friendly lizards. Don’t forget to taste the delicious local food! Try some fresh fish or the famous Hvar lamb, which is super yummy.
One of the hidden gems is the small, quiet beaches around Sućuraj. They are great spots to relax and have a picnic. Sućuraj is also a fantastic place to start your adventures on the nearby islands and other parts of Hvar, making it perfect for both short trips and longer visits.
